Web55°42′58″N 4°43′19″W  / . 55.7162°N 4.7219°W. / 55.7162; -4.7219. Drakemyre or Drakemire was once a distinct village on the Rye Water in North Ayrshire, Parish of Dalry, Scotland. The settlement on the B780 road to Kilbirnie has become incorporated as a suburb within the town of Dalry.
